Easy to clean
Look for cribs that come with removable mattress covers that can be washed with the machine while looking at bedside cribs or travel cots. This will keep it clean and free of dribbles, leaky diapers, and spit-up. It is also recommended to choose one that is easily disassembled, allowing you to clean and sanitise all the corners.
This is vital, as it's the best way to be sure that all dirt and germs have been cleared away. Verify that the sides of the crib are securely attached to ensure that your baby won't fall off or be trapped.
You'll also need to make sure that the crib is easy to clean and that it fits with your bed. This is especially important in the case of a co-sleeping bedside crib. These cribs are designed to be connected securely to the parent's side, which gives parents to easily access to their child throughout the night to feed and comfort their baby while still ensuring the safety that separate sleeping surfaces offer.
When you are choosing a crib to put at your bedroom take into consideration whether it has extra features that could be beneficial to you. Some cribs tilt or rock, which is ideal for babies who tend to be fussy.
It is also important to make sure that your crib or travel cot has a firm and flat mattress that is able to fit snugly into the frame. This will decrease the risk of SIDS because your baby's feet and head won't fall into any folds or gaps in the bedding.
It's also an excellent idea to purchase a new mattress for your cot, crib or travel bed, rather than using one that was handed down from another person or bought second-hand. Mattresses that are used tend to lose their shape with time and increase the risk of SIDS. All new cribs must meet BS EN 1130:2019, the latest standard that imposes stricter requirements for safe and effective sleep solutions.
Versatile
A bedside crib (or co-sleeping crib as they're sometimes known) can be attached to your bed to allow you to reach your baby easily at night, without needing to get out of your bed to sleep. They can also be used as a standalone crib during the daytime. They usually have a side panel that can be moved down so you can feel and see your baby. Some cribs allow you to keep the panel in place all night, which gives you the intimacy and convenience of sleeping in a bed with your newborn however it reduces the risk of bed sharing. Some cribs can be transformed into a travel cot. Others have additional features, such as tilting, rocking or converting into an older baby cot.
